• linkedu视频
  • 平面设计
  • 电脑入门
  • 操作系统
  • 办公应用
  • 电脑硬件
  • 动画设计
  • 3D设计
  • 网页设计
  • CAD设计
  • 影音处理
  • 数据库
  • 程序设计
  • 认证考试
  • 信息管理
  • 信息安全
菜单
linkedu.com专业计算机教程网站
  • 网页制作
  • 数据库
  • 程序设计
  • 操作系统
  • CMS教程
  • 游戏攻略
  • 脚本语言
  • 平面设计
  • 软件教程
  • 网络安全
  • 电脑知识
  • 服务器
  • 视频教程
  • html/xhtml
  • html5
  • CSS
  • XML/XSLT
  • Dreamweaver教程
  • Frontpage教程
  • 心得技巧
  • bootstrap
  • vue
  • AngularJS
  • HBuilder教程
  • css3
  • 浏览器兼容
  • div/css
  • 网页编辑器
  • axure
您的位置:首页 > 网页设计 >html5 > HTML5-XMLHttpRequest Level 2概述详解

HTML5-XMLHttpRequest Level 2概述详解

作者:匿名 字体:[增加 减小] 来源:互联网 时间:2018-12-03

本文主要包含HTML5,XMLHttpRequest ,Level等相关知识,匿名希望在学习及工作中可以帮助到您
1.概述
XMLHttpRequest Level 2是对XMLHttpRequest增强,具有cross-origin支持性。

2.浏览器支持性检测

 if (typeof xhr.withCredentials === undefined) 
   {   
      document.getElementById("support").innerHTML =  
         "Your browser <strong>doesnot</strong> support cross-origin                     
         XMLHttpRequest"; 
   } 
   else 
   { 
      document.getElementById("support").innerHTML =  
         "Your browser <strong>does</strong> support cross-origin                        
         XMLHttpRequest";
   }

3.新的事件名称
在XMLHttpRequest Level 2之前,XMLHttpRequest请求与响应的状态使用一些数值进行表示,类似于枚举。XMLHttpRequest Level 2使用命名的事件代替请求与响应的不同状态,这些命名事件具有相应的事件属性,可以将事件处理函数赋予各事件的事件属性。
XMLHttpRequest对象有一些事件,如:loadstart, progress, abort, error, load, upload, loaded等。

这些事件可以看作XMLHttpRequest的子对象,并且它们有一些事件属性,
XMLHttpRequest本身具有一些事件属性和事件。XMLHttpRequest事件属性有XMLHttpRequest.onprograss, XMLHttpRequest.onload, XMLHttpRequest.onerror等。
可以在事件处理程序函数中传入一个参数e,e具有一些与事件和数据信息相关的属性,比如:e.total, e.loaded, e.uploaded, e.downloaded, e.lengthComputable等。

以上就是HTML5-XMLHttpRequest Level 2概述详解的详细内容,更多请关注微课江湖其它相关文章!

您可能想查找下面的文章:

  • HTML5知识点总结
  • HTML5的本地存储
  • HTML5本地存储之IndexedDB
  • Html5实现文件异步上传功能
  • Html5新标签datalist实现输入框与后台数据库数据的动态匹配
  • 详解HTML5 window.postMessage与跨域
  • HTML5拖放API实现拖放排序的实例代码
  • 解决html5中video标签无法播放mp4问题的办法
  • HTML5新特性 多线程(Worker SharedWorker)
  • Html5新增标签有哪些

相关文章

  • 2018-12-03H5学习之旅-H5的块标签的使用(9)
  • 2018-12-03HTML5新特性之用SVG绘制微信logo _html5教程技巧
  • 2018-12-03分享文字溢出隐藏实例
  • 2018-12-03详细介绍h5中的history.pushState()使用实例
  • 2018-12-03html5通过postMessage进行跨域通信的方法_html5教程技巧
  • 2018-12-03分享一个HTML5电子杂志翻书特效代码
  • 2018-12-03详细介绍7款让人惊叹的HTML5粒子动画特效详解
  • 2018-12-03Web前端面试题面试技巧有哪些?
  • 2018-12-03SVG基础|SVG图形填充颜色
  • 2018-12-03一波HTML5 Canvas基础绘图实例代码集合_html5教程技巧

文章分类

  • html/xhtml
  • html5
  • CSS
  • XML/XSLT
  • Dreamweaver教程
  • Frontpage教程
  • 心得技巧
  • bootstrap
  • vue
  • AngularJS
  • HBuilder教程
  • css3
  • 浏览器兼容
  • div/css
  • 网页编辑器
  • axure

最近更新的内容

    • HTML5 Canvas 绘图——使用 Canvas 绘制图形图文教程 使用html5 canvas 绘制精美的图_html5教程技巧
    • W3C 为什么工作效率很低?
    • HTML5 新旧语法标记对我们有什么好处
    • html5 video标签屏蔽右键视频另存为的js代码_html5教程技巧
    • 如何使用H5做出上传图片功能
    • JS每日一题-小demo之JS实现通过键盘方向键操作图片上下左右无缝切换
    • 做导航栏为什么用ul>li,而不用dd dt dl?
    • 为什么有些网页一开始不显示内容,等不耐烦了关掉的时候却显示了内容一闪而过?
    • 用html5的canvas画布绘制贝塞尔曲线完整代码
    • HTML5 video标签(播放器)学习笔记(一):使用入门

关于我们 - 联系我们 - 免责声明 - 网站地图

©2020-2025 All Rights Reserved. linkedu.com 版权所有